Cape Hatteras is the perfect beach to visit if you’re a nature lover. It has a coastline that stretches for around 72 miles and there are several fishing towns dotted along the edge.
The Atlantic Ocean offers a great spot for surfing, so windsurfers and kiteboarders flock to Cape Hatteras when the weather’s good!

Beachwalker Park is a haven for sporty people. There’s lots on offer: canoeing, kayaking, tennis, golf, cycling, and more!
The unspoiled landscape around the beach goes on for miles and the tidal inlets are a great place to watch the seabirds in their natural habitat.
Beachwalker Park is a great place to take a walk and have a picnic!
